Cilk Plus编译器是一种用于并行编程的工具,它可以在多核处理器上实现高效的并行计算。然而,在安装Cilk Plus编译器时,可能会遇到一些问题。以下是可能导致在macOS Catalina和Xcode 11上安装Cilk Plus编译器出错的一些常见原因和解决方法:
- 兼容性问题:macOS Catalina和Xcode 11可能与旧版本的Cilk Plus编译器不兼容。解决方法是确保使用最新版本的Cilk Plus编译器,并查看其是否与macOS Catalina和Xcode 11兼容。
- 缺少依赖项:安装Cilk Plus编译器可能需要一些依赖项,如特定的库文件或软件包。在安装之前,确保已经安装了所有必需的依赖项,并按照它们的安装要求进行操作。
- 安装权限问题:在macOS Catalina上,系统可能会限制对某些目录或文件的写入权限。尝试使用管理员权限或超级用户权限运行安装程序,以确保具有足够的权限来安装Cilk Plus编译器。
- 安全设置问题:macOS Catalina引入了更严格的安全设置,可能会阻止安装未经验证的软件。在安装Cilk Plus编译器之前,您可能需要调整系统的安全设置,以允许安装来自未知开发者的软件。
- Xcode配置问题:Xcode 11可能需要进行一些配置才能正确识别和使用Cilk Plus编译器。确保在Xcode的设置中正确配置了Cilk Plus编译器,并将其设置为默认编译器。
总结起来,要在macOS Catalina和Xcode 11上安装Cilk Plus编译器,您应该确保使用最新版本的Cilk Plus编译器,并检查其与操作系统和开发工具的兼容性。同时,确保安装了所有必需的依赖项,并具有足够的权限来进行安装。如果遇到安全设置或Xcode配置问题,需要相应地进行调整。